Managing lost and found items in senior living facilities requires special care and attention. When residents misplace personal belongings—especially those in memory care units—having a clear, organized system for reporting and returning found items is essential for maintaining resident dignity, family trust, and operational efficiency.
This Senior Living Facility Found Item Report template is designed specifically for assisted living, independent living, and memory care communities. It enables staff members to quickly document found items with detailed descriptions, correlate items with resident rooms and common areas, and initiate appropriate family contact protocols when needed.
Unlike generic lost and found forms, this template addresses the specific challenges senior living facilities face. It includes fields for memory care considerations, resident identification details, item location tracking, and family notification preferences. Staff can document whether an item was found in a resident room, common area, dining hall, or during activities, making it easier to match items with their owners.
The form captures essential staff finder details including name, department, and shift information, creating accountability and making follow-up communication seamless. For memory care residents who may not be able to identify their belongings independently, the form includes protocols for family contact and verification.
